Best 95835 California Public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 10 public schools serving 10,369 students in 95835, CA (there are 2 private schools, serving 30 private students). 100% of all K-12 students in 95835, CA are educated in public schools (compared to the CA state average of 90%).
The top ranked public schools in 95835, CA are Westlake Charter, Natomas Charter and Heron.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 95835 have an average math proficiency score of 33% (versus the California public school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 51% (versus the 47% statewide average). Schools in 95835, CA have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of California public schools.
Minority enrollment is 85%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is more than the California public school average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
